Enzymology and Enzyme Technologies provides a structured introduction to enzymes, their biological significance, molecular structure and practical applications. The book explains enzyme classification, nomenclature, active sites, cofactors, coenzymes and metalloenzymes before progressing to enzyme isolation, purification, assays and characterization. It presents the essential principles of enzyme kinetics, including Michaelis–Menten kinetics, Km, Vmax and the effects of pH and temperature. The regulation and inhibition of enzyme activity are discussed alongside isoenzymes, schizomers and isoschizomers. Advanced topics include ribozymes, catalytic RNA and enzyme immobilization. By connecting fundamental enzymology with applications in biotechnology, agriculture, medicine, food processing, industry and environmental science, the book serves as a useful academic resource for undergraduate and postgraduate students of biochemistry, biotechnology, microbiology, food science and related life-science disciplines.
